2. 3. 读取Header 要读取CSV文件的Header,我们只需要调用next()函数即可获取第一行数据,即Header。 header=next(csv_reader) 1. 4. 输出Header 最后,我们可以输出Header,以便查看CSV文件的列名。 print(header) 1. 结论 通过以上步骤,你已经学会了如何使用Python读取CSV文件的Heade
在读取CSV文件时,我们通常需要先获取header信息,以便更好地理解数据。 读取CSV文件header 要读取CSV文件的header信息,我们可以使用Python的pandas库。下面是一个简单的示例,演示了如何读取CSV文件的header信息: importpandasaspd# 读取CSV文件data=pd.read_csv('data.csv')# 获取header信息header=data.columns.tolist()...
要在Python中读取CSV文件并指定header行,你可以使用Python的内置csv模块或者更高级的pandas库。这里我将分别展示这两种方法。 使用Python的csv模块 如果你想要使用Python的csv模块来读取CSV文件并指定header行,你通常需要手动处理这个过程,因为csv模块本身不直接支持指定header行。但你可以通过跳过不需要的行来间接实现这一...
pip install pandas 2.Python代码示例 以下是完整的Python代码示例: importpandasaspd# 定义CSV文件路径csv_file_path ='example.csv'# 读取CSV文件,指定header所在的行(从0开始计数)# 假设表头在第3行(索引为2)df = pd.read_csv(csv_file_path, header=2)# 显示读取的数据框(DataFrame)print(df)# 如果需要...
header: int or list of ints, default ‘infer’ 指定行数用来作为列名,数据开始行数。如果文件中没有列名,则默认为0,否则设置为None。如果明确设定header=0 就会替换掉原来存在列名。header参数可以是一个list例如:[0,1,3],这个list表示将文件中的这些行作为列标题(意味着每一列有多个标题),介于中间的行将...
pandas的 read_csv 函数用于读取CSV文件。以下是一些常用参数: filepath_or_buffer: 要读取的文件路径或对象。 sep: 字段分隔符,默认为,。 delimiter: 字段分隔符,sep的别名。 header: 用作列名的行号,默认为0(第一行),如果没有列名则设为None。
在数据分析和处理中,经常需要读取外部数据源,例如CSV文件。Python的pandas库提供了一个强大的 read_csv() 函数,用于读取CSV文件并将其转换成DataFrame对象,方便进一步分析和处理数据。在本文中,将深入探讨 read_csv() 函数中的 io 参数,该参数是读取数据的关键部分,并提供详细的示例代码。
read_csv 参数详解 pandas的 read_csv 函数用于读取CSV文件。以下是一些常用参数: filepath_or_buffer: 要读取的文件路径或对象。 sep: 字段分隔符,默认为,。 delimiter: 字段分隔符,sep的别名。 header: 用作列名的行号,默认为0(第一行),如果没有列名则设为None。
read_csv('data.csv', encoding='utf-8') 指定列名: 如果CSV文件的第一行包含列名,则它们将被自动识别并用作DataFrame的列标签。如果你需要指定自己的列名,可以使用header参数。例如,如果列名在第二行: data = pd.read_csv('data.csv', header=1) 数据转换: 你可以使用converters参数来指定如何转换特定列的...
在Python中,可使用pandas库的read_csv()函数来读取CSV文件。read_csv()函数的基本语法如下: import pandas as pd df = pd.read_csv('file.csv') 复制代码 其中,‘file.csv’ 是待读取的CSV文件的路径。读取CSV文件后,将其存储为一个DataFrame对象,这样可以方便地对数据进行操作和分析。 read_csv()函数还有...